Originally aired on television January 16, 2007 as an episode of Frontline.
Summary
More than 10,000 children have reportedly been sexually abused by Catholic priests in the United States in recent decades. Filmmaker Joe Cultrera tells the personal story of how his brother Paul was molested in the 1960s by Father Joseph Birmingham, reported to have abused nearly 100 other children. Paul Cultrera kept his secret for 30 years before confronting the church and starting his own investigation into how the Archdiocese of Boston covered up allegations against Father Birmingham and moved him from parish to parish. The Cultrera family tells their story of faith betrayed by the scandal that has engulfed the Catholic Church.
